I've raised working dogs (Malinois, Samoyed, Chinook, Buhund, Kuvasz, etc.), and I've also raised a few rescues. It's been my requirement that my rescues contain no pit lineage. In re: the PP's question about terriers, I think people who don't like them object to their tenacity, feistiness, and propensity for noise and nipping. I've had family Airedales and Jack Russells, and while I can appreciate them as Good Dogs, I can also say I wouldn't choose them as my own pets.
